Ryzen 7 9800X3D

To see what this processor can deliver, we paired it with the RTX 4070 Ti and ran a handful of games. In Counter-Strike 2, running at 1080p low settings, we got 604 FPS, and in Cyberpunk 2077, this CPU delivered 334 FPS. However, when we turned on PBO, the FPS in CS2 increased to 669 FPS, which is a massive increase.

So, paired with the RTX 5080, you should experience even better FPS, and there is no chance of a bottleneck playing at low resolutions, but with this gaming PC, you’ll likely be playing at 4K or 1440p with very high FPS.

RTX 5080

Nvidia RTX 5080 FE front on, Image by PCGuide
Nvidia RTX 5080 FE, Image by PCGuide

While we’re not sure which RTX 5080 will come in this gaming PC, we’ve reviewed the Founder Edition model as well as the ROG Astral RTX 5080 OC. We’ll be using the findings of the FE model for reference. We paired it with the 9800X3D and ran plenty of games, but we’ll take the example of Cyberpunk 2077 and CS2 first.

Cyberpunk 2077 ran at 213 FPS at 1080p, 151 FPS at 1440p, and 72 FPS at 4K. In CS2, we got 468, 346, and 188 FPS in the same three resolutions. Besides that, in other titles like F1 24, this card had no issues pushing 84 FPS at 4K, and overall, this is a solid GPU for 4K gaming, and that is without factoring in DLSS 4 and MFG.

To push this GPU to its limit, we turned on ray tracing (overdrive mode) at 4K and saw the FPS dip to 19. However, with leveraging DLSS 4 and turning MFG to 4X, the game ran at 183 FPS, which is just incredible.
